The Turkish Bath Experience
After exploring the highlights of Kusadasi, the tour group heads to the traditional Turkish bath, or hamam, for a rejuvenating experience.
The group is led to a private, temperature-controlled marble room where they’ll undergo a 30-minute scrub foam massage. This centuries-old bathing ritual promotes relaxation and cleansing.
Skilled attendants gently exfoliate the skin, leaving it soft and glowing. Participants then have time to lounge in the hot, steamy room, allowing the heat to soothe aching muscles.
The Turkish bath experience is a cultural highlight, offering a chance to unwind and take in the local wellness traditions.

Discover the Region’s History
As travelers explore the charming streets of Kusadasi, they’ll discover the town’s rich history that dates back centuries. Founded in the 11th century BC, Kusadasi was an important port city for the ancient Ionian civilization.
Remnants of this past can be seen in the archaeological sites throughout the town, including the impressive Fortress of Kusadasi. Visitors can also visit the nearby ancient city of Ephesus, once a thriving hub of Greco-Roman culture.
